Overview

Postcode BB2 2TY is located in an urban city, within the Livesey with Pleasington ward of Blackburn with Darwen in the North West region, and forms part of the Meadowhead area. It has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 51.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Meadowhead is £39,569 per year. The nearest station is Cherry Tree located about 0.2 miles away. There are 7 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area.

Property prices in Livesey with Pleasington

Based on 214 recent sales, the median property price is £259,972 in Livesey with Pleasington area, with individual transactions ranging from £87,000 up to £875,000.
